کامپیوترهای کوانتومیکامپیوتر کوانتومی چیست؟همه چیز درباره کامپیوترهای کوانتومیبراستی کامپیوتر کوانتومی چیست؟ این مقاله عالی به بررسی و معرفی کامپیوترهای کوانتومی به زبان ساده پرداخته است، همچنین قدرت کامپیوترهای کوانتومی را بررسی کرده بهنوعی از کامپیوترکامپیوتر چیست؟ ⚡️ کامپیوتر چیست به زبان سادهاین مقاله عالی توضیح داده که کامپیوتر چیست و چه کاربردی دارد و همه چیز درباره کامپیوتر از جمله فواید کامپیوتر و تعریف کامپیوتر و اجزای آن را بیان کرده است ها گفته میشود که اساس کار آنها بر پایه فیزیک کوانتوم است. در این کامپیوترها بهجای استفاده از بیت (Bit) از کیوبیت (Qubit) استفاده میشود که یک برتری محسوب میشود، این امر باعث میشود تا فرایند پردازش اطلاعات بهطورکلی با کامپیوترهای کلاسیک فرق کند. در کامپیوترهای کلاسیک، هر بیت میتواند یکی از مقادیر 0 یا 1 را داشته باشد، پردازش اطلاعات و انجام عملیات بر روی این بیتها صورت میپذیرد؛ اما در کامپیوتر های کوانتومی قضیه متفاوت است؛ در کامپیوتر های کوانتومی، یک کیوبیت میتواند مقدار 0 و 1 را به طور همزمان داشته باشد، به این خاصیت بهاصطلاح برهمنهی یا Superposition میگویند. کیوبیتها ویژگی دیگری با نام درهمتنیدگی یا Entanglement دارند؛ به این صورت که وضعیت یا State یک کیوبیت به کیوبیتهای دیگر وابسته است، این ویژگی در واقع یکی از مزیت های کامپیوتر های کوانتومی است که در بسیاری از مواقع مورداستفاده قرار میگیرد؛ بهعنوانمثال به طور همزمان میتوان عملیاتی را بر روی چند کیوبیت انجام داد.
ویژگیها و مزیتهای گفته شده از کیوبیتها، کامپیوتر های کوانتومی را قادر میسازد تا بعضی از عملیات را به طور قابلتوجهی سریعتر از کامپیوترهای کلاسیک انجام دهند؛ بهعنوانمثال حلکردن بعضی از مسائل رمزنگاریرمزنگاری چیست؟ بررسی انواع رمزنگاری و ویژگی های رمزنگاریرمزنگاری چیست و چگونه کار میکند؟ این مقاله عالی به معرفی رمز نگاری، انواع رمزنگاری از جمله متقارن و نامتقارن، الگوریتم های رمزنگاری و تاریخچه آن پرداخته است و یا جستجو به مراتب سریعتر انجام میشود؛ همچنین بعضی از مسائل کلاسیک با پیشرفتهتر شدن کامپیوتر های کوانتومی جای خودشان را به مسائل کوانتومی میدهند. باتوجهبه ویژگیهای مطرح شده، کامپیوتر های کوانتومی دارای مزایای فراوانی هستند که در لیست زیر مهمترین آنها ذکر شده است:
- سرعت بالا
- پردازش موازی
- حل مسائل بهینهسازی
- شبیهسازی سیستمهای کوانتومی
- رمزنگاری
در ادامه مقاله به توضیح هرکدام از موارد ذکر شده میپردازیم.
سرعت بالا
کامپیوتر های کوانتومی به دلیل استفاده از ویژگیهای کوانتومی و فیزیک کوانتوم، مسائل مشخصی را بسیار سریعتر از کامپیوترهای کلاسیک حل میکنند، این موضوع باعث شده تا بسیاری از حوزهها وارد حیطه پردازشهای کوانتومی شوند. با استفاده از کامپیوتر های کوانتومی میتوان بسیاری از الگوریتمالگوریتم چیست به زبان ساده و با مثال های فراواندر این مقاله به زبان بسیار ساده و با مثال های متعدد توضیح داده شده که الگوریتم چیست و چه کاربردهایی داردهای رمزنگاری کنونی که برای تضمین امنیت دادههای حساس مورد استفاده قرار میگیرند را شکست داد، این الگوریتمها بر اساس تجزیه اعداد بزرگ کار میکنند. در کامپیوترهای کلاسیک، تجزیه اعداد بزرگ کار زمانبری است؛ حال آن که در کامپیوتر های کوانتومی با سرعت بسیار بالایی میتوان این تجزیهها را انجام داد.
پردازش موازی
کامپیوتر های کوانتومی از مزیت Superposition بهره میبرند، این ویژگی به ما اجازه میدهد تا بتوانیم محاسبات را به صورت همزمان انجام دهیم؛ برخلاف کامپیوتر های کلاسیک که محاسبات در آنها به صورت ترتیبی پردازش میشوند. پردازش موازی یا Parallel Processing یک مزیت بسیار مهمی محسوب میشود و در بسیاری از زمینهها میتواند ما را کمک کند؛ به عنوان مثال در تحلیل دادهها و یادگیری ماشینیادگیری ماشین چیست و چرا مهم است؟ - Machine learning (ML)تعریف یادگیری ماشین : ماشین لرنینگ (Machine Learning یا به اختصار ML) باعث میشود که خود ماشینها با آنالیز داده ها امکان یادگیری و پیشرفت داشته باشند، این مقاله فوق العاده یادگیری ماشین را بصورت کامل بررسی کرده است، کامپیوتر های کوانتومی قادر هستند تا دیتاستهای بزرگ و حجیم را به صورت همزمان پردازش کنند و الگوهای پیچیده بین آنها را با سرعت بالاتری نسبت به کامپیوترهای کلاسیک تشخیص دهند، این موضوع باعث میشود مسائل دنیای واقعی، مانند بهینه سازی زنجیرهی تامین (Supply Chain) و یا تشخیص ناهمگونی در تراکنشهای مالی و بسیاری از مسائل دیگر را مدل سازی و پیشبینی کرد. نتیجه کلی حاصل از پردازشهای موازی این است که سرعت کامپیوترهای کوانتومیسرعت کامپیوترهای کوانتومیاین صفحه عالی به بررسی سرعت کامپیوترهای کوانتومی فعلی پرداخته و بررسی کرده که آیا در آینده کامپیوترهای کوانتومی جایگزین کامپیوترهای کلاسیک میشوند یا خیر در بسیاری از مسائل بسیار بالاتر از کامپیوترهای کلاسیک است.
حل مسائل بهینه سازی
مسائل بهینهسازی به آن دسته از مسائلی گفته میشود که جوابهای بسیار زیاد و گوناگونی دارند؛ اما قصد ما این است که بهترین جواب یا همان بهینهترین جواب را پیدا کنیم؛ بهعنوانمثال خط تولید کارخانه به چه شکلی باشد که بیشترین تولید را با کمترین هزینه انجام دهد. حل مسائل بهینهسازی بهوسیله الگوریتم های بهینه سازیالگوریتم های بهینه سازی از سیر تا پیازالگوریتم های بهینه سازی چیست؟ این صفحه عالی توضیح داده که الگوریتم های بهینه سازی چگونه کار می کنند و مهمترین الگوریتم های بهینه سازی را معرفی کرده توسط کامپیوترهای کلاسیک صورت میپذیرد. مشکلی که وجود دارد این است که محاسبات این الگوریتمها بسیار زیاد است و حلکردن آن توسط کامپیوترهای کلاسیک فرایند زمانبر و هزینهبری است. کامپیوترهای کوانتومی بهوسیله الگوریتمهای کوانتومی مانند الگوریتم بهینهسازی تقریبی کوانتومی یا Quantum Approximate Optimization Algorithm (QAOA) میتوانند بر این چالشها غلبه کنند؛ بهعنوانمثال در صنعت لاجستیک و نقل و انتقالات، نیاز داریم تا مسیرهای بهینهای را پیدا کنیم تا هزینه و زمان انتقال را کاهش دهیم؛ بهوسیله کامپیوتر های کوانتومی پیداکردن این مسیرها در زمان بسیاری کمی انجام میشود.
شبیه سازی سیستم های کوانتومی
از دیگر مزایای کامپیوتر های کوانتومی این است که در شبیهسازی سیستمهای کوانتومی بهتر عمل میکنند؛ درحالیکه شبیهسازی سیستمهای کوانتومی در کامپیوترهای کلاسیک بادقت بالایی انجام نمیشود. با شبیهسازیکردن رفتار ذرات کوانتومی و مولکولها بهوسیله کامپیوترهای کوانتومی، میتوان به پیشرفت علوم مواد و مسائل شیمی کمک شایانی کرد، این امر به محققین اجازه میدهد تادانش بالاتری از رفتار و تعاملهای بین مشخصههای ذرات کوانتومی کسب کنند که خود این موضوع باعث پیشرفت درعلوم دیگری میشود؛ بهعنوانمثال توسعه مادههای جدید، ایجاد برنامههای مختلف و بسیاری از موارد دیگر.
رمز نگاری
هرچند که تاکنون بهوسیله کامپیوتر های کوانتومی الگوریتمهای رمزنگاری کلاسیک را کرک نکردهاند، اما گمان میشود تا در آیندهای نزدیک این عمل صورت بگیرد. کامپیوتر های کوانتومی بهوسیله پتانسیلی که دارند، قادر هستند تا مسائل ریاضیاتی مربوط به رمزنگاری مانند تجزیه اعداد بزرگ که پایه و اساس الگوریتمهای رمزنگاری امروزی هستند را حل کنند. در حال حاضر محققین در حال تلاش برای توسعه الگوریتمهای رمزنگاریای هستند که در برابر پردازشهای کوانتومی مقاوم باشند. در الگوریتمهای رمزنگاری کوانتومیرمزنگاری کوانتومی چیست؟ ⚡️نحوه کارکرد + مزایااین مقاله عالی گفته رمزنگاری کوانتومی چیست و چگونه کار می کند، همچنین مزایای رمزنگاری کوانتومی و محدودیت های رمزنگاری کوانتومی را بررسی کرده ، از خاصیتهای فیزیک کوانتومی استفاده میشود تا تضمین شود در آینده میتوان از کرکشدن دادههای رمز شده و حساس توسط کامپیوتر های کوانتومی جلوگیری کرد.
جمع بندی
کامپیوتر های کوانتومی از مواردی هستند که محققین به آینده آن امیدوارند و هر ساله شاهد پیشرفتهای چشمگیری در عرصه پردازش کوانتومی هستیم. کامپیوتر های کوانتومی دارای مزایای بسیاری نسبت به کامپیوترهای کلاسیک هستند. در این مقاله به پنج تا از مهم ترین مزایای کامپیوتری پرداختیم و در مورد هرکدام از آنها توضیحاتی دادیم. بسیاری از موارد مطرح شده در اوایل راه هستند و جای کار بسیار زیادی دارند؛ اما باتوجه به رشد روزافزونی که دارند، امید داریم تا در آینده بتوانیم از مزایای فراوان کامپیوتر های کوانتومی بهرهمند شویم.
مزایای کامپیوترهای کوانتومی چیست؟
کامپیوتر های کوانتومی قادر هستند تا پردازشهای بسیار زیادی را در زمان خیلی کم انجام دهند؛ بنابراین حل مسائل بهینهسازی، ایجاد الگوریتمهای کوانتومی، شبیهسازی سیستمهای کوانتومی و... در زمان بسیار کوتاهی نسبت به کامپیوترهای کلاسیک صورت میپذیرد.
علت سرعت زیاد کامپیوترهای کوانتومی نسبت به کامپیوترهای کلاسیک چیست؟
کامپیوتر های کوانتومی از خاصیتهای فیزیک کوانتومی مانند برهمنهی (Superposition) و درهمتنیدگی (Entanglement) بهره میبرند؛ همچنین بهجای استفاده از بیت، از کیوبیت استفاده میکنند که قادرند چند مقدار بهصورت همزمان داشته باشند؛ تمامی این ویژگیها باعث میشود تا پردازشهای کوانتومی با سرعت بالاتری نسبت به کامپیوترهای کلاسیک انجام شود.